Local Anesthetic Toxicity in Epidural Analgesia for Elderly Patients: A Case Report
Thi Anh Tuyet Cao1, Thang Toan Nguyen2,3
1Department of Anesthesiology, Saint Paul General Hospital, Hanoi, Vietnam.
Background:
Elderly patients have a higher likelihood of undergoing surgical procedures compared to younger populations, a factor associated with increased perioperative mortality and anesthesia-related morbidity. Regional anesthesia in geriatric patients offers a favorable safety profile, optimizes analgesia, and contributes to reducing postoperative complications, particularly within the framework of enhanced recovery after surgery (ERAS) protocols. Nevertheless, local anesthetic systemic toxicity (LAST) remains a rare yet potentially life-threatening complication in the context of epidural analgesia. Its severity is amplified in scenarios involving prolonged local anesthetic infusion or in patients with elevated susceptibility due to age-related physiological changes or comorbidities.
Case Presentation:
A case report details an instance of LAST induced by continuous epidural administration of bupivacaine 0.1% in a 95-year-old female patient following surgery for bowel obstruction. We describe the clinical presentation, diagnostic considerations, therapeutic interventions, and subsequent recovery.
Conclusion:
Epidural analgesia is an effective method of pain relief, providing prolonged and continuous analgesia with a relatively low risk of systemic toxicity. Nevertheless, LAST may still occur, particularly during prolonged administration or in vulnerable populations, such as elderly patients and those with hepatic, renal, or cardiovascular dysfunction. In the critical care setting, clinicians should maintain a high index of suspicion for LAST while excluding other differential diagnoses, including shock, stroke, or pulmonary embolism. Importantly, the potential accumulation of local anesthetics during epidural analgesia should be considered even when dosing adheres to current recommendations, as age-related physiological and pharmacokinetic changes may increase susceptibility to toxicity. This case also highlights the important role of intravenous lipid emulsion (ILE) as an effective rescue therapy in the management of LAST, with rapid improvement in neurological manifestations following treatment.
